    Overview

    The Front Line Supervisor, Material Control is a leadership role responsible for supporting the Material Control operations. Operating under the BIW Business Operating System (BOS), this position ensures safe, high-quality, and efficient execution of trade work to support ship/unit construction schedules. This role provides technical and resource management for Material Control activities and plays a key role in coaching and mentoring mechanics to strengthen trade performance and team effectiveness.

    Key Responsibilities

    Safety Leadership:

    • Champion BIW safety culture and enforce all safety standards and procedures across operations.

    • Ensure proper PPE use, hazard awareness, and adherence to safe work practices.

    • Support safety training and continuous improvement in workplace safety performance.

    Project Execution:

    • Perform analysis and maintenance of MacPac generated kit reports
    • Monitor the quality of work performed; ensure first-time quality through proper oversight and training.
    • Support Plan of the Week (POW) execution and coordinate with area management to align resources with operational needs.

    Operational Management:

    • Plan, organize and coordinate work of Material Handlers in a warehouse environment.
    • Ensure employees are executing inventory transactions in a manner that maintains an accurate inventory.
    • Interface routinely with Production Management, Production Control, and Planning regarding material issues and status.
    • Effectively communicate and maintain a safe, productive working relationship with the Hourly Team, Salaried Team, and Union Representatives.
    • Ensure accountability of task and goal completion.
    • Understand, support, and administer the union labor contract.- Use electronic time accounting system (WFM) to maintain employees time, overtime, and work order charges daily.

    Mentoring & Team Development:

    • Provide leadership and mentoring to employees under your charge.

    • Ensure procedures and process controls are well-documented and communicated to the personnel charged with executing the tasks.

    • Promote continuous learning and skills development for mechanics.

    Continuous Improvement:

    • Participate in Business Operating System (BOS) principles and productivity enhancements.
    • Incorporate the Plan-Do-Check-Act model to ensure sustainment of the improvements established.
